Davis Polk Advises Sumitomo Mitsui Banking Corporation on $2 Billion Concurrent Guaranteed Senior Bond Offerings

Davis Polk advised Sumitomo Mitsui Banking Corporation in connection with its $2 billion senior debt offering in reliance on the Section 3(a)(2) exemption of the Securities Act. The offering consisted of $500 million of 1.45% senior bonds due 2016, $500 million of 2.5% senior bonds due 2018, $700 million of 3.95% senior bonds due 2023 and $300 million of 3.95% senior floating-rate bonds due 2016, each guaranteed by Sumitomo Mitsui Banking Corporation’s New York branch. The joint lead managers for the offering were Goldman, Sachs & Co., Citigroup Global Markets Inc., Barclays Bank PLC, Merrill Lynch, Pierce, Fenner & Smith Incorporated and SMBC Nikko Securities Inc.
